Herunterladen Inhalt Inhalt Diese Seite drucken

Verwendung Von Benutzerdefinierten Webseiten Konfigurieren - Siemens SIMATIC S7 Systemhandbuch

Automatisierungssystem
Vorschau ausblenden Andere Handbücher für SIMATIC S7:
Inhaltsverzeichnis

Werbung

Namens- und Verwendungsklauseln
Die AWP-Befehle AWP_In_Variable, AWP_Out_Variable, AWP_Enum_Def,
AWP_Enum_Ref, AWP_Start_Fragment und AWP_Import_Fragment haben
Namensklauseln. HTML-Formularbefehle wie <input> und <select> haben ebenfalls
Namensklauseln. AWP_In_Variable und AWP_Out_Variable können zusätzlich
Verwendungsklauseln haben. Unabhängig vom Befehl ist die Syntax von Namens- und
Verwendungsklauseln hinsichtlich der Handhabung von Sonderzeichen die gleiche:
● Der Text, den Sie für eine Namens- oder Verwendungsklausel angeben, ist in einfache
● Innerhalb einer Namens- oder Verwendungsklausel sind Datenbausteinnamen und PLC-
● Wenn ein Variablenname oder Datenbausteinname ein einfaches Anführungszeichen
Tabelle 11- 2 Beispiele für Namensklauseln
Datenbausteinname
-/-
nicht zutreffend
Datenbaustein_1
Datenbaustein_1
Datenbaustein_1
DB A' B C D$ E
Für Verwendungsklauseln gelten die gleichen Konventionen wie für Namensklauseln.
Hinweis
Unabhängig von den Zeichen, die Sie in Ihrer HTML-Seite verwenden, legen Sie als
Zeichensatz der HTML-Seite UTF-8 fest und speichern die Seite im Editor mit der
Zeichenverschlüsselung UTF-8.
11.3.3

Verwendung von benutzerdefinierten Webseiten konfigurieren

Um benutzerdefinierte Webseiten in STEP 7 zu konfigurieren, gehen Sie folgendermaßen
vor:
1. Wählen Sie die CPU in der Gerätekonfiguration aus.
S7-1200 Automatisierungssystem
Systemhandbuch, 04/2012, A5E02486681-06
Anführungszeichen zu setzen. Handelt es sich bei dem Namen in Anführungszeichen um
eine PLC-Variable oder einen Datenbausteinnamen, setzen Sie die gesamte Klausel in
einfache Anführungszeichen.
Variablennamen in doppelte Anführungszeichen zu setzen.
oder einen rückwärts gerichteten Schrägstrich ("Backslash") enthält, stellen Sie dem
Zeichen einen Backslash als Escape-Zeichen voran. Der rückwärts gerichtete
Schrägstrich "\" dient bei der Übersetzung der AWP-Befehle als Escape-Zeichen.
Variablenname
ABC'DEF
A \B 'C :D
Variable_1
ABC'DEF
A \B 'C :D
Variable
11.3 Benutzerdefinierte Webseiten
Möglichkeiten für Namensklauseln
Name='"ABC\'DEF"'
Name='"A \\B \'C :D"'
Name='"Datenbaustein_1".Tag_1'
Name='"Datenbaustein_1".ABC\'DEF'
Name='"Datenbaustein_1".A \\B \'C :D'
Name='"DB A\' B C D$ E".Variable'
Webserver
567

Werbung

Inhaltsverzeichnis
loading

Diese Anleitung auch für:

Simatic s7-1200

Inhaltsverzeichnis